返回

Vue3 实战笔记:快速入门及开发环境搭建

前端

快速掌握 Vue3:打造高效且响应式的前端应用程序

体验 Vue3 的强大功能

Vue3 是一个现代且功能强大的前端框架,它使开发人员能够轻松构建交互式和响应式应用程序。其新颖特性、高性能和易用性使其成为开发人员的首选。本指南将引导您快速上手 Vue3,并分享在实际项目中至关重要的实用知识。

轻松入门 Vue3

踏入 Vue3 的旅程从设置开发环境开始。Vite 是一款轻量级构建工具,它提供了热更新和快速构建等优点。使用以下步骤安装 Vite:

npm install -g vite

创建一个新的 Vue3 项目:

vite create my-vue3-app

进入项目目录并启动开发服务器:

cd my-vue3-app
npm run dev

现在,您已经准备好在 Vue3 中编写代码。让我们创建一个简单的示例来展示其基本用法:

<template>
  <div id="app">
    <h1>{{ message }}</h1>
    <button @click="changeMessage">改变信息</button>
  </div>
</template>

<script>
import { ref } from 'vue'

export default {
  setup() {
    const message = ref('Hello Vue3!')

    const changeMessage = () => {
      message.value = '你好,Vue3!'
    }

    return {
      message,
      changeMessage
    }
  }
}
</script>

<style>
#app {
  font-family: Avenir, Helvetica, Arial, sans-serif;
  text-align: center;
  color: #2c3e50;
  margin-top: 60px;
}
</style>

在示例中,我们使用了 Vue3 的 refsetup 特性来实现响应式数据绑定和方法调用。运行此示例,您将看到一个包含文本和按钮的页面。单击按钮后,文本内容将更改。

在项目中掌握 Vue3

入门 Vue3 后,是时候在实际项目中应用它的力量了。以下是一些关键知识点:

1. 组件库搭建

组件库是前端开发中的基石,它允许您快速构建复杂的 UI 界面。Vue3 提供了多种出色的组件库,例如 Element UI 和 Ant Design Vue。利用这些库,您可以使用或自定义现成的组件。

2. 项目架构设计

项目架构是项目可维护性和可扩展性的关键。Vue3 支持多种流行的架构,例如 MVVM、Flux 和 Redux。根据您的项目需求,选择最合适的架构。

3. 性能优化

性能是前端开发的重中之重。Vue3 提供了多种性能优化技术,例如代码分割、懒加载和缓存。实施这些技术可显着提升您的应用程序的加载速度和响应能力。

结论

Vue3 是一个出色的框架,它赋予您构建交互式和响应式应用程序的能力。本指南为您提供了入门 Vue3 的基础,并分享了在项目中至关重要的知识点。拥抱 Vue3 的强大功能,开启高效和创新的前端开发之旅。

常见问题解答

1. Vue3 和 Vue2 有什么区别?

Vue3 引入了新特性,例如组合 API、更好的类型推断和改进的性能。

2. 如何优化 Vue3 应用程序的性能?

代码分割、懒加载和缓存是提高 Vue3 应用程序性能的有效技术。

3. 如何在 Vue3 中创建组件库?

您可以使用脚手架或从头开始构建自己的组件库。

4. Vue3 中推荐的项目架构是什么?

根据您的项目需求,MVVM、Flux 或 Redux 架构可能是合适的。

5. Vue3 的未来是什么?

Vue3 仍在积极开发中,预计会有更多特性和改进。